Windows 7 Check for Updates Never Finishes

Windows 7 Check for Updates Never Finishes

While Windows 7 has been succeeded by newer operating systems, it continues to hold its ground among many users.

But even its steadfast followers occasionally encounter the frustrating issue of ‘Windows 7 check for updates never finishes.’

This leaves their systems lagging on the security and performance fronts. Let’s dive deep into understanding the causes of this issue and exploring step-by-step solutions to fix it.

Windows 7 Check for Updates Never Finishes

Exploring the Causes of the Windows 7 Check for Updates Never Finishes Issue

There are several possible reasons behind the endless checking for updates on Windows 7:

Outdated Windows Update Software: The Windows Update software itself may be outdated, leading to problems when checking for new updates.

Heavy Traffic on Microsoft’s Servers: Sometimes, if there are a large number of requests to Microsoft’s servers, it may cause delays or seeming unresponsiveness in the update process.

Corrupted System Files: System files crucial for the update process might be corrupted, causing the update check to hang indefinitely.

Software Conflicts: Certain third-party software can interfere with the Windows Update process, preventing it from completing.

Unfolding the Solutions for the Windows 7 Check for Updates Never Finishes Issue

Understanding the root causes paves the way for practical solutions. Here are some step-by-step fixes:

Solution 1: Update Windows Update

It might seem a bit strange, but sometimes the Windows Update software itself is outdated and needs updating.

Microsoft periodically releases update packages for Windows Update, which you can download and install manually from the Microsoft Update Catalog.

Search for the latest “Windows Update Client” followed by your system type (32-bit or 64-bit) and the month and year, download it, and run the installer.

Solution 2: Try During Off-Peak Hours

If the issue is due to heavy traffic on Microsoft’s servers, you may have better luck checking for updates during off-peak hours, such as late in the evening or early in the morning.

Solution 3: Use Windows System File Checker

The System File Checker (SFC) is a utility in Windows that allows users to scan for corruptions in Windows system files and restore corrupted files. Here’s how to use it:

Step 1: Click ‘Start’, type ‘cmd’ in the search box.

Step 2: Right-click ‘cmd’ and choose ‘Run as administrator’.

Step 3: In the command prompt, type ‘sfc /scannow’ and press Enter.

Step 4: Restart your computer after the scan and repair process completes.

Solution 4: Temporarily Disable Third-Party Software

Some third-party software, especially security software, can interfere with the Windows Update process.

Try disabling these applications temporarily and see if the update check completes. Remember to re-enable the software afterward.


The ‘Windows 7 Check for Updates Never Finishes’ issue can be a frustrating roadblock to keeping your system updated and secure.

However, the comprehensive understanding of causes and practical solutions provided in this guide should help you navigate this issue effectively.

Remember that Microsoft no longer officially supports Windows 7, so for the best performance and security, consider upgrading to a newer version of Windows.


Please enter your comment!
Please enter your name here